... Read moreIf you're a fan of sushi and seafood, combining salt and pepper shrimp with sushi is a fantastic way to enjoy a flavorful and nutritious meal. Salt and pepper shrimp is typically lightly battered and seasoned with a blend of spices, making it a crispy, savory addition to traditional sushi rolls or even served on the side as a complementary dish. From a dietary perspective, shrimp offers a low-calorie, high-protein option that fits well into many diet plans. As seafood generally provides valuable nutrients such as omega-3 fatty acids, vitamins, and minerals, incorporating fish and shrimp into your meals can support heart health and overall wellbeing. When preparing salt and pepper shrimp sushi at home or trying it at a restaurant, consider balancing the flavors by including fresh vegetables like cucumber, avocado, or radish in the roll. These ingredients add texture, nutrients, and freshness that elevate the eating experience. For those watching their diet, choose brown rice sushi options or opt for rolls with minimal sauces to reduce added sugars and fats. Additionally, pairing sushi with a side of miso soup or seaweed salad can increase the nutritional value of your meal without adding significant calories.
